Canada forward Olivia Smith has become the most expensive player in women’s soccer history at a cost of one million pounds ($1.34 million) after Arsenal signed her from Liverpool.

Former Arsenal and Manchester City star Bacary Sagna has urged Liverpool players to properly process the death of Diogo Jota by speaking to someone about their grief.
